Teyana Taylor, the 35-year-old actress, dancer, and singer, took home the Golden Globe for Best Supporting Actress at the 83rd annual ceremony on Sunday night. Her win, for her role in One Battle After Another, marked her first major award—and her reaction was nothing short of unforgettable. When presenters Jennifer Garner and Amanda Seyfried announced her name, Teyana was visibly stunned, bursting into tears before even reaching the stage. And this is the part most people miss: her speech was a rollercoaster of raw emotion, humor, and even a bleeped-out curse word that had the audience in stitches.

“Oh my God, this s— is heavy,” she joked, cradling her trophy, immediately breaking the tension with laughter. But beneath the humor was a deep sense of disbelief. “I almost didn’t even write a speech because I didn’t think I would get this,” she admitted, her voice trembling. She even gave a shout-out to her kids, playfully scolding them to put down their phones and watch her moment of triumph. It was a reminder that behind every celebrity is a real person, with real nerves and real family dynamics.

Teyana’s speech wasn’t just about her win; it was a heartfelt tribute to her cast and crew. She thanked her One Battle After Another family, including director, writer, and co-producer Paul Thomas Anderson, whom she affectionately called “Paul ‘Let ‘Em Cook’ Thomas Anderson.” Her gratitude was palpable, and her words, “My gratitude is endless. I love you, we love you,” felt genuinely sincere. She also gave a nod to her co-stars, including Leonardo DiCaprio, Sean Penn, Benicio Del Toro, Chase Infiniti, Regina Hall, and everyone involved in the project.

The audience responded with a standing ovation, clearly moved by her authenticity. Teyana’s win was particularly significant because One Battle After Another led the nominations with nine nods, including Best Picture – Musical/Comedy, Director, and Lead Actor/Actress. The film’s success was matched by other standout projects like Sentimental Value (8 nominations) and Sinners (7 nominations). On the TV side, The White Lotus (HBO) dominated with 6 nominations, followed by Adolescence (Netflix) and Only Murders in the Building (Hulu) with 5 and 4 nominations, respectively.

Speaking of Hulu, Teyana also stars in the Kim Kardashian-led legal drama All’s Fair, which premiered in November. Despite initially harsh reviews and a 0% Rotten Tomatoes score, the show saw a massive resurgence, becoming one of Hulu’s biggest drops ever.
